Undergraduate Students take part in Summer Research Programs Poster Session 2023

NSF REU “Green Chemistry” student Luke Leach presents his summer research poster entitled Effect of Plant Oil-based Monomers Unsaturation Degree on Adhesion Performance of Structural Acrylic Adhesives at NDSU Summer Research Programs Poster Session and presents short oral presentation. Group presents at Fall ACS meeting in Chicago

Our research group gives three presentations at 2022 Fall American Chemical Society meeting Sustainability in Changing World hold in Chicago, IL on August, 21-25. Tetiana Shevtsova presents poster  entitled “Bioplastic Proteoposite Films from Plant Proteins for Food Packaging Applications”, Bohdan Domnich gives oral presentation on ” Highly biobased latex adhesives from plant-oil derived monomers and isobornyl methacrylate”.

Andriy Voronov gives an invited talk “Plant Oil-Based Latexes : Effect of Unsaturation”. All three presentations are given at Green Polymer Chemistry & Sustainability symposium organized by Division of Polymer Chemistry.

Ukrainian NDSU students describe fears, yet have hope for their devastated nation

Our group members, Yehor Polunin  and Bohdan Domnich, participate in the panel discussion “War in Ukraine”,   organized by the NDSU Department of Political Science & Public Policy and moderated by Thomas Ambrosio, Professor of Political Science at NDSU

On Thursday, March 24, Yehor and Bohdan have been part of the presentation at the panel where showed vivid images and videos they had retrieved from social media and friends about the devastation to schools, shopping centers, residential buildings, orphanages, train depots, hospitals, cultural treasures and nuclear plants.

Zoriana, Oksana received Travel Grants to attend National and International Conference

Zoriana attended 10th Workshop on Fats and Oils as Renewable Feedstock for the Chemical Industry hold in Karlsruhe, Germany on March, 17-19. She presented a poster on her research entitled The Effect of Unsaturation on Properties of High Biobased Content Plant Oil-Based Latexes and Latex Materials. To travel to Germany, Zoriana received a grant from Non-Profit Association for the Advancement of Research on Renewable Raw Materials, abiosus e.V. organizing the workshop in cooperation with the Agency of Renewable Resources (FNR).
